如何快速安全地下载千亿国际网页内容的实用攻略
在信息化快速发展的今天,越来越多的人希望能够高效、安全地获取网页内容,无论是科研、学习还是工作中,数据的获取都至关重要。尤其在面对海量的千亿级网页内容时,如何实现快速、安全地下载成为许多用户关注的焦点。以下将为您详细介绍实现这一目标的方法与技巧。
明确目标,制定合理的下载策略
在开始大量网页内容的下载之前,首要任务是明确需求。不同的场景对下载速度、数据完整性以及安全性有不同的要求。例如,科研项目可能更重视数据的完整性与准确性,而普通用户可能更关注下载速度。
合理的策略可以有效提升效率。例如,采用分批次下载或按类别筛选下载内容,避免一次性请求过多数据导致服务器拒绝服务或本地系统崩溃。此外,还应考虑设置合理的请求频率,以防止因频繁请求被目标网站封禁。

选择专业工具与技术保障安全
在确保策略合理的基础上,选择合适的工具至关重要。当今市场上有许多高效的网页爬取工具和框架,如Scrapy、BeautifulSoup等。这些工具具备灵活配置参数的能力,能够支持自定义请求头、模拟浏览器行为,从而在保证下载速度的同时避免触发反爬机制。
同时,为了确保安全,建议在操作中引入代理IP池。通过使用不同的IP进行请求,可以有效避免因频繁访问而导致的封禁,同时帮助保持匿名保障个人隐私。此外,对请求内容进行加密,确保传输的敏感信息安全,也是保障整个过程安全的重要措施。
优化网络环境,提升下载效率
一个稳定且快速的网络环境是实现高速下载的基础。建议使用高速宽带连接,减少网络延迟,避免带宽限制导致的下载阻塞。针对大量数据的传输,可以优化本地硬件配置,确保硬盘具有足够的写入速度。
此外,利用多线程、多进程技术可以显著提升下载效率。例如,分配多个线程同时下载不同网页内容,合理调配资源,有效缩短整体时间。需要注意的是,合理控制并发数量,避免因过高的请求

需求表单